I have a copy of Max_Sea and I use it because of the weather feature and as a potential back-up to my Navionics/Raymarine main system but it has similar but different inaccuracies.

I am on a mooring ball off Puerto Moralos Mexico.

The Navionics is out by 800 yds and shows me outside the reef when I am 400 yds inside the reef. The Max-Sea shows me to be on landward side of the main square at a bus stop in front of a very pretty church, again the error is close to 800 yds.

The two systems are running off completely different GPS systems which both show the same exact position.

However, due to the use of the reliable Mark #1 eyeball I know exactly where I am!
